I'm looking for some help here. My MP3 came with a 50mm summilux that has a 43mm filter size. I also bought a 24mm f2.8 that has a 55mm filter size. As it happens, I have a Universal M polarizer that can fit 39-46-49mm threads but not the 43mm or 55mm. Is there any way I can use my universal M polarizer? If not, is there a way to use a polarizer on the lenses I have?
 
Time to search ebay and all the used camera places.

Leica made a swing out polarizer for the 43 mm size in the past. Basically it looks like the new universal polarizer, with a fixed hood added, and the 43mm ring is part of the polarizer body vs. the seperate ring of the newer universal.

The part number was 13351 if I remember correctly.

It looks like this picture of the 39mm variation # 13352 which I borrowed from Sherry Krauter's site.
